Crafting the Perfect Graduation Message
So, how do you craft the perfect graduation message? First, personalization is key. Instead of relying on generic phrases, try to include specific details about the graduate’s journey, their strengths, or memorable moments. Acknowledge their hard work and mention something unique about their accomplishments. For example, if they overcame a particular challenge or excelled in a specific area, highlight that in your message.
Next, be genuine. Write from the heart and let your true feelings shine through. Whether you’re feeling proud, excited, or hopeful for their future, express those emotions authentically. Avoid clichés and instead focus on conveying your sincere congratulations and well wishes. Your honesty will make the message more meaningful and impactful. Also, keep your message positive and uplifting. Graduation is a time of celebration, so focus on the graduate’s achievements and the exciting opportunities that lie ahead. Offer words of encouragement and express your confidence in their ability to succeed in their future endeavors. Avoid dwelling on past challenges or uncertainties, and instead, highlight their potential and the bright future that awaits them.
Finally, keep it concise. While it’s important to be thoughtful and sincere, avoid writing a lengthy message that overwhelms the graduate. Keep your message focused and to the point, highlighting the most important sentiments you want to convey. A well-crafted, concise message can be just as impactful as a longer one, and it will ensure that your words are remembered and appreciated.
Graduation Message Examples
To give you some inspiration, here are a few examples of graduation messages you can adapt and personalize:
For High School Graduates
"Hey [Graduate's Name], huge congrats on graduating high school! It feels like just yesterday we were [insert a fun memory]. Now you're off to bigger and better things! I'm so incredibly proud of everything you've achieved. Wishing you all the best as you head off to college (or whatever amazing adventure you choose)! Never forget how awesome you are!"
"[Graduate's Name], congratulations on this momentous achievement! Your hard work and dedication have paid off. Remember all those late-night study sessions? Totally worth it! As you embark on your next journey, may you continue to shine brightly and achieve all your dreams. We're all cheering you on!"
For College Graduates
"Wow, [Graduate's Name], you did it! Congratulations on graduating from college! All those all-nighters and exams finally paid off. I’ve always admired your determination and drive. Wishing you the best as you start your career. Go get 'em!"
"[Graduate's Name], what an incredible accomplishment! Graduating from college is a huge milestone, and you’ve earned every bit of it. Your future is so bright, and I can't wait to see all the amazing things you'll achieve. Congratulations and best of luck in your next adventure!"
For Postgraduate Graduates
"[Graduate's Name], congratulations on achieving your postgraduate degree! This is a testament to your intellectual curiosity and unwavering dedication. I am so impressed by your commitment to learning and growth. Wishing you continued success and fulfillment in your career!"
"Huge congrats, [Graduate's Name], on earning your postgraduate degree! This is a significant achievement that reflects your passion and expertise. May your knowledge and skills make a positive impact on the world. Wishing you all the best in your future endeavors!"
General Messages
"Congratulations on your graduation! May this special day be the beginning of a bright and successful future. Your hard work and perseverance have brought you to this moment, and I have no doubt you will continue to achieve great things."
"Wishing you all the best on your graduation day! May your future be filled with happiness, success, and endless opportunities. Embrace the challenges ahead and never stop pursuing your dreams. Congratulations!"
Tips for Making Your Message Stand Out
To make your graduation message truly stand out, consider adding a personal touch that reflects your relationship with the graduate. Share a funny or heartwarming memory, inside joke, or a specific detail that highlights their unique qualities. This will show that you put thought and effort into crafting the message and make it more meaningful to the recipient.
You could also include a motivational quote or piece of advice that resonates with the graduate’s aspirations and goals. Choose a quote that inspires them to pursue their dreams, overcome challenges, and make a positive impact on the world. This will not only uplift their spirits but also provide them with valuable guidance as they embark on their next chapter.
Creative Delivery: Instead of just sending a text or email, consider writing your message in a handwritten card or including it with a thoughtful gift. A physical card adds a personal touch and allows the graduate to keep your message as a cherished memento. Alternatively, you could create a personalized video message, sharing your congratulations and well wishes in a fun and engaging way.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
When crafting your graduation message, there are a few common mistakes to avoid. First, don’t make it about yourself. Graduation is a time to celebrate the graduate’s achievements, so keep the focus on them. Avoid sharing personal stories or experiences that detract from their special day.
Also, avoid generic or insincere messages. A generic message can come across as impersonal and thoughtless, diminishing the impact of your congratulations. Instead, take the time to craft a personalized message that reflects your genuine feelings and acknowledges the graduate’s unique accomplishments.
Finally, be mindful of your tone. Avoid using negative or critical language, and instead, focus on positivity and encouragement. Graduation is a time of celebration, so keep your message upbeat and uplifting.
